The Vietnam In-Memory Computing Market was estimated at USD 231 Million in 2025 and is projected to reach USD 325 Million by 2032, growing at a CAGR of 5.4% from 2026 to 2032.
The increasing demand for real-time data processing is the driving force behind the Vietnam In-Memory Computing Market. Organizations across various sectors are recognizing the necessity of rapid data analytics to enhance operational efficiency and gain a competitive edge.
As businesses embrace digital transformation, the appetite for in-memory computing solutions continues to rise. This technology not only accelerates data handling but also supports the deployment of advanced analytics, empowering firms to make swift and informed decisions.

Despite the promising growth, the market faces notable challenges. The high cost associated with in-memory computing solutions remains a primary barrier, especially for smaller organizations that struggle to justify the investment. on top of that, there is a significant gap in awareness regarding the potential benefits of these technologies. Many businesses do not fully grasp how in-memory computing can transform their operations. Additionally, ensuring data consistency and integrity within these systems is crucial; lapses here can undermine the reliability of real-time analytics and decision-making.
Current trends highlight a surge in demand for in-memory computing solutions driven by the proliferation of IoT and AI technologies. Companies are increasingly relying on high-speed data processing capabilities to support these innovations. Additionally, organizations are focusing on integrating in-memory computing with cloud services to enhance scalability and flexibility. This shift is particularly evident in sectors like finance and retail, where real-time customer insights are paramount.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
